Marinated Cucumber, Tomato and Onion Salad

Marinated Cucumber, Tomato and Onion Salad is a refreshing dish made with sliced cucumbers, cut tomatoes, separated onion rings, and a simple marinade of water, vinegar, oil, sugar, salt and pepper. Perfect for summer or as a light lunch.

Course: Salad
Cuisine: American
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 2 hours
Total Time: 2 hours 15 minutes
Servings: 5

Ingredients

  • 1 cup of water
  • 1/2 cup of distilled white vinegar
  • 1/4 cup of vegetable oil
  • 1/4 cup of sugar
  • Salt amount to taste
  • Black pepper freshly ground, amount to taste
  • 3 cucumbers peeled and sliced into 1/4 inch pieces
  • 3 tomatoes cut into wedge-shaped pieces
  • 1 onion sliced and separated into rings

Instructions

  • Assemble all necessary ingredients.
  • In a large mixing bowl, combine water, distilled white vinegar, vegetable oil, sugar, salt, and pepper. Whisk until the mixture is well blended.
  • Add the sliced cucumbers, wedged tomatoes, and separated onion rings to the bowl. Stir until all ingredients are evenly coated.
  •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and place it in the refrigerator for a minimum of 2 hours.
